Carne is looking for an experienced and passionate Head Chef to lead the kitchen team at our well-established restaurant in Hove. Known for our creative menu and commitment to using fresh, locally sourced produce, Carne has built an excellent reputation for quality food and outstanding service.

Previous experience working as a Head Chef is required.

How to prepare for a job interview at Rock Recruitment

Know Your Ingredients

Familiarise yourself with the local produce and suppliers that Carne uses. Being able to discuss your favourite ingredients and how you would incorporate them into the menu will show your passion and knowledge about the role.

Showcase Your Creativity

Prepare a few unique dish ideas that align with Carne's creative menu. Presenting your concepts during the interview can demonstrate your culinary skills and innovative thinking, which are crucial for a Head Chef.

Team Leadership Skills

Be ready to discuss your experience in leading a kitchen team. Share specific examples of how you've motivated staff, handled conflicts, or improved kitchen efficiency. This will highlight your ability to manage and inspire a team.

Passion for Quality Service

Emphasise your commitment to outstanding service. Discuss how you ensure that every dish meets high standards and how you train your team to maintain this quality. This aligns perfectly with Carne's reputation for excellence.
